--TEST--
Test crc32() function : error conditions
--SKIPIF--
<?php
if (PHP_INT_SIZE != 4)
die("skip this test is for 32bit platform only");
?>
--FILE--
<?php
/* Prototype : string crc32(string $str)
* Description: Calculate the crc32 polynomial of a string
* Source code: ext/standard/crc32.c
* Alias to functions: none
*/
/*
* Testing crc32() : error conditions
*/
echo "*** Testing crc32() : error conditions ***\n";
// Zero arguments
echo "\n-- Testing crc32() function with Zero arguments --\n";
var_dump( crc32() );
//Test crc32 with one more than the expected number of arguments
echo "\n-- Testing crc32() function with more than expected no. of arguments --\n";
$str = 'string_val';
$extra_arg = 10;
var_dump( crc32($str, $extra_arg) );
echo "Done";
?>
--EXPECTF--
*** Testing crc32() : error conditions ***
-- Testing crc32() function with Zero arguments --
Warning: crc32() expects exactly 1 parameter, 0 given in %s on line %d
NULL
-- Testing crc32() function with more than expected no. of arguments --
Warning: crc32() expects exactly 1 parameter, 2 given in %s on line %d
NULL
Done
